How we Help

Sohocolab uses systems thinking to analyze how people, materials, and processes interact, identifying measurable opportunities to improve efficiency, reduce waste, and strengthen program outcomes. Through observation, research, and implementation, we deliver actionable insights that enhance resource stewardship and community impact.

We partner with nonprofits, schools, sports organizations, businesses, and public agencies through targeted projects, technical support, education, and applied research.

Textiles & Materials Stewardship

Practical Guidance with Transparency

The way materials are selected, used, maintained, and recovered influences cost, performance, environmental impact, and long-term value. We help organizations better understand their material systems and identify practical opportunities to improve stewardship, transparency, and circularity.

Includes​​

  • Material Transparency Assessments

  • Textile Life Cycle Reviews

  • Resource Stewardship Strategies

  • Circular Material Systems Strategy
